The 1982 album 'La Peur' found Hallyday embracing a harder, more contemporary hard rock sound, moving away from the more pop-oriented material of previous years. This record marked a significant stylistic shift in his long career.

Johnny Hallyday was a French rock and roll singer, often called the "French Elvis." By 1982, he had been a dominant figure in French music for over two decades, known for his electrifying live performances and his ability to adapt rock music for French audiences.
